Portrait of Louisa Charlotte Tyndall (1845-1940) Size:Standard: 6 x 4in The bird is posed standingThe sitter appears in half profile, facing left, her face shadowed and her hair worn up. Louisa Tyndall's dress is light brown, edged with lace and heavily embroidered panels in a leaf design. Around her neck, held on a claret ribbon, is a heavy gold pendant, with the word 'ROMA' just visible. Intended to commemorate her wedding and to be viewed with the companion work, John Tyndall. Signed 'V. Zippenfeld' [fl. 1834 1871]. Original: oil on canvas,
